The B trail thru bigwin park is closed for the season (bridges). You would have to detour north up to baysville on d101, 45, d102 then go south on d103 back to the B trail or take 44 west across to D trail south. Not sure on timing. D101, 45 102 are fast sweeping turns logging roads and d103 and 44 are tighter cottage roads with some fast sections. 44 has some wild hill crests on it.
